package google import ( "errors" "fmt" "net/url" "strconv" "strings" "github.com/karust/openserp/core" regionpkg "github.com/karust/openserp/core/region" "github.com/sirupsen/logrus" ) // GoogleDomains maps language/country hints to Google TLD suffixes used for // URL construction. var GoogleDomains = map[string]string{ "": "com", "en": "com", "ac": "ac", "ad": "ad", "ae": "ae", "af": "com.af", "ag": "com.ag", "ai": "com.ai", "al": "al", "am": "am", "ao": "co.ao", "ar": "com.ar", "as": "as", "at": "at", "au": "com.au", "az": "az", "ba": "ba", "bd": "com.bd", "be": "be", "bf": "bf", "bg": "bg", "bh": "com.bh", "bi": "bi", "bj": "bj", "bn": "com.bn", "bo": "com.bo", "br": "com.br", "bs": "bs", "bt": "bt", "bw": "co.bw", "by": "by", "bz": "com.bz", "ca": "ca", "kh": "com.kh", "cc": "cc", "cd": "cd", "cf": "cf", "cat": "cat", "cg": "cg", "ch": "ch", "ci": "ci", "ck": "co.ck", "cl": "cl", "cm": "cm", "cn": "cn", "co": "com.co", "cr": "co.cr", "cu": "com.cu", "cv": "cv", "cy": "com.cy", "cz": "cz", "de": "de", "dj": "dj", "dk": "dk", "dm": "dm", "do": "com.do", "dz": "dz", "ec": "com.ec", "ee": "ee", "eg": "com.eg", "es": "es", "et": "com.et", "fi": "fi", "fj": "com.fj", "fm": "fm", "fr": "fr", "ga": "ga", "gb": "co.uk", "ge": "ge", "gf": "gf", "gg": "gg", "gh": "com.gh", "gi": "com.gi", "gl": "gl", "gm": "gm", "gp": "gp", "gr": "gr", "gt": "com.gt", "gy": "gy", "hk": "com.hk", "hn": "hn", "hr": "hr", "ht": "ht", "hu": "hu", "id": "co.id", "iq": "iq", "ie": "ie", "il": "co.il", "im": "im", "in": "co.in", "io": "io", "is": "is", "it": "it", "je": "je", "jm": "com.jm", "jo": "jo", "jp": "co.jp", "ke": "co.ke", "ki": "ki", "kg": "kg", "kr": "co.kr", "kw": "com.kw", "kz": "kz", "la": "la", "lb": "com.lb", "lc": "com.lc", "li": "li", "lk": "lk", "ls": "co.ls", "lt": "lt", "lu": "lu", "lv": "lv", "ly": "com.ly", "ma": "co.ma", "md": "md", "me": "me", "mg": "mg", "mk": "mk", "ml": "ml", "mm": "com.mm", "mn": "mn", "ms": "ms", "mt": "com.mt", "mu": "mu", "mv": "mv", "mw": "mw", "mx": "com.mx", "my": "com.my", "mz": "co.mz", "na": "com.na", "ne": "ne", "nf": "com.nf", "ng": "com.ng", "ni": "com.ni", "nl": "nl", "no": "no", "np": "com.np", "nr": "nr", "nu": "nu", "nz": "co.nz", "om": "com.om", "pa": "com.pa", "pe": "com.pe", "ph": "com.ph", "pk": "com.pk", "pl": "pl", "pg": "com.pg", "pn": "pn", "pr": "com.pr", "ps": "ps", "pt": "pt", "py": "com.py", "qa": "com.qa", "ro": "ro", "rs": "rs", "ru": "ru", "rw": "rw", "sa": "com.sa", "sb": "com.sb", "sc": "sc", "se": "se", "sg": "com.sg", "sh": "sh", "si": "si", "sk": "sk", "sl": "com.sl", "sn": "sn", "sm": "sm", "so": "so", "st": "st", "sv": "com.sv", "td": "td", "tg": "tg", "th": "co.th", "tj": "com.tj", "tk": "tk", "tl": "tl", "tm": "tm", "to": "to", "tn": "tn", "tr": "com.tr", "tt": "tt", "tw": "com.tw", "tz": "co.tz", "ua": "com.ua", "ug": "co.ug", "uk": "co.uk", "uy": "com.uy", "uz": "co.uz", "vc": "com.vc", "ve": "co.ve", "vg": "vg", "vi": "co.vi", "vn": "com.vn", "vu": "vu", "ws": "ws", "za": "co.za", "zm": "co.zm", "zw": "co.zw", } // googleDefaultCountryByLanguage maps a language subtag to the country Google // associates with it when the user did not provide an explicit region. var googleDefaultCountryByLanguage = map[string]string{ "en": "us", "pt": "br", "zh": "cn", "ja": "jp", "ko": "kr", } // BuildURL builds a Google web search URL from Query fields. // It returns an error when the resulting query text is empty or invalid. func BuildURL(q core.Query) (string, error) { locale := googleLocale(q.LangCode, q.Region) googleBase := googleDomain(locale) base, err := url.Parse(fmt.Sprintf("https://www.google.%s", googleBase)) if err != nil { return "", err } base.Path += "search" params := url.Values{} // Set request text if q.Text != "" || q.Site != "" || q.Filetype != "" { text := q.Text if q.Site != "" { text += " site:" + q.Site } if q.Filetype != "" { text += " filetype:" + q.Filetype } logrus.WithField("query_hash", core.QueryHash(text)).Trace(fmt.Sprintf("Query text: %s", text)) params.Add("q", text) params.Add("oq", text) } if len(params.Get("q")) == 0 { return "", errors.New("empty query built") } // Set search date range if q.DateInterval != "" { intervals := strings.Split(q.DateInterval, "..") if len(intervals) != 2 { return "", errors.New("incorrect date interval provided") } dataParam := fmt.Sprintf("cdr:1,cd_min:%s,cd_max:%s", intervals[0], intervals[1]) params.Add("tbs", dataParam) } // Limit number of results if q.Limit > 10 { params.Add("num", strconv.Itoa(q.Limit)) } // Set result offset for pagination if q.Start < 0 { return "", errors.New("incorrect start param provided") } if q.Start > 0 { params.Add("start", strconv.Itoa(q.Start)) } // Google default is filter=1; send only when user asks to include similar results. if !q.Filter { params.Add("filter", "0") } if locale.country != "" { params.Add("gl", locale.country) } if uule := googleUULE(q.Region); uule != "" { params.Add("uule", uule) } if locale.language != "" { params.Add("hl", locale.language) params.Add("lr", "lang_"+locale.language) } params.Add("pws", "0") // Do not personalize search results params.Add("sourceid", "chrome") params.Add("ie", "UTF-8") base.RawQuery = params.Encode() return base.String(), nil } // BuildImageURL builds a Google image search URL from Query fields. // It returns an error when the resulting query text is empty or invalid. func BuildImageURL(q core.Query) (string, error) { // TODO: Add new params locale := googleLocale(q.LangCode, q.Region) googleBase := googleDomain(locale) base, err := url.Parse(fmt.Sprintf("https://www.google.%s", googleBase)) if err != nil { return "", err } base.Path += "search" params := url.Values{} params.Add("tbm", "isch") // Search images // Set request text if q.Text != "" || q.Site != "" || q.Filetype != "" { text := q.Text if q.Site != "" { text += " site:" + q.Site } if q.Filetype != "" { text += " filetype:" + q.Filetype } params.Add("q", text) params.Add("oq", text) } if len(params.Get("q")) == 0 { return "", errors.New("empty query built") } // Set search date range if q.DateInterval != "" { intervals := strings.Split(q.DateInterval, "..") if len(intervals) != 2 { return "", errors.New("incorrect date interval provided") } dataParam := fmt.Sprintf("cdr:1,cd_min:%s,cd_max:%s", intervals[0], intervals[1]) params.Add("tbs", dataParam) } // Limit number of results if q.Limit > 10 { params.Add("num", strconv.Itoa(q.Limit)) } if locale.country != "" { params.Add("gl", locale.country) } if uule := googleUULE(q.Region); uule != "" { params.Add("uule", uule) } if locale.language != "" { params.Add("hl", locale.language) params.Add("lr", "lang_"+locale.language) } params.Add("pws", "0") // Do not personalize search results base.RawQuery = params.Encode() return base.String(), nil } type googleLocaleParams struct { language string country string } // googleLocale parses langCode and fills in a default country when one is not // supplied so callers always get a usable (gl, hl) pair. func googleLocale(langCode, region string) googleLocaleParams { parsed := core.ParseLocale(langCode) country := strings.ToLower(core.CountryFromRegion(region)) if parsed.Language == "" { if country != "" { return googleLocaleParams{country: country} } return googleLocaleParams{} } if country == "" { country = strings.ToLower(parsed.Country) if country == "" { country = defaultGoogleCountry(parsed.Language) } } return googleLocaleParams{ language: parsed.Language, country: country, } } func defaultGoogleCountry(language string) string { if country, ok := googleDefaultCountryByLanguage[language]; ok { return country } // Many ISO 639-1 codes also exist as ccTLDs in GoogleDomains // (e.g. "de", "fr", "ru"); fall back to that mapping when present. if _, ok := GoogleDomains[language]; ok { return language } return "us" } // googleDomain picks a Google ccTLD for the resolved locale, preferring the // country, then the language, then the global "com" default. func googleDomain(locale googleLocaleParams) string { if domain, ok := GoogleDomains[locale.country]; ok { return domain } if domain, ok := GoogleDomains[locale.language]; ok { return domain } return GoogleDomains[""] } // googleUULE builds a Google UULE v1 value for a region hint. The resolution // and encoding live in the dependency-free core/region subpackage. func googleUULE(region string) string { return regionpkg.GoogleUULE(region) } // SourceImage contains parsed Google image metadata extracted from result links. type SourceImage struct { PageURL string OriginalURL string Width string Height string } func parseSourceImageURL(href string) (SourceImage, error) { source := SourceImage{} href = strings.ReplaceAll(href, ";", "&") parsed, err := url.QueryUnescape(href) if err != nil { return source, err } u, err := url.Parse(parsed) if err != nil { return source, err } queryMap, err := url.ParseQuery(u.RawQuery) if err != nil { return source, err } val, ok := queryMap["h"] if ok && len(val) > 0 { source.Height = val[0] } val, ok = queryMap["w"] if ok && len(val) > 0 { source.Width = val[0] } val, ok = queryMap["imgrefurl"] if ok && len(val) > 0 { source.PageURL = val[0] } val, ok = queryMap["imgurl"] if ok && len(val) > 0 { source.OriginalURL = val[0] } return source, nil }
